I agree with you about the GFX. My 92 is my daily driver, it's also a V6, and the one I put those gauges in (they're pricier for the 90-92 because they need to be custom made from original bezel & housing). I also have an 89 that I'm working on as a project, but it already has the V8 (TBI 305). All I've been able to do with it so far is fix the suspension and install headers and cat-back exhaust - engine work comes later after more suspension work and drive-line upgrades.

Sounds like you've already decided which way to go with them. Keep one as a daily driver and fix the other as you see fit It's hard to beat the gas mileage of the V6.
